I've done some work with court ordered volunteers. I don't know how they were in the rest of their lives, but I can say that many of the people with DUIs were interested in working hard and putting this behind them.

However, there were also the people with DUIs who made an appointment to come in then had to cancel it for an unexpected emergency. They rescheduled only to cancel again for another "emergency." They were either the unluckiest people who ever lived or they couldn't stay sober even to work off their DUIs - and they couldn't admit to us or themselves that they had a problem.
